Grasping Official Representative Solutions
Certified representative solutions play a critical role in the conformity and executive structure of enterprises, especially limited entities and incorporations. A registered representative acts as the assigned entity or firm responsible for collecting legal papers, for example notifications of court cases or official conformity correspondence, on behalf of a enterprise entity. This function is essential for upholding favorable status in the perspective of governmental authorities and guaranteeing swift reception of crucial lawful details.
One of the primary obligations of a registered agent is overseeing process serving dispatch. When a company is sued or needs to be apprised of lawful matters, the official proxy is the designated contact for such communications. It is vital for entities to have a dependable registered proxy, as failure to receive these notices can result in overlooked due dates and potentially detrimental legal repercussions. Cost Factors for Registered Agent Solutions
As selecting a registered agent provider, grasping the associated costs is essential for companies. Registered agent services can vary widely in price, with costs typically spanning twenty to two hundred dollars per year. Factors influencing these fees include the agent's reputation, the range of services provided, and the location of the enterprise. It is important to evaluate what value the registered agent offers, as the cheapest option may not always deliver the best services or support.
Aside from the basic annual fee, businesses should also be mindful of any extra costs that may arise. Some registered agent companies charge extra for services like document handling, compliance reminders, and mail forwarding. registered agent change filing can accumulate rapidly, so it is advisable to get a comprehensive understanding of the total cost associated with the chosen registered agent provider. This transparency is vital to ensure budget compliance and avoid unexpected expenditures.

Modifying Your Registered Agent: What You Need to Know
Changing your registered agent is a key step in ensuring compliance for your business entity. If you discover your current registered agent is not fulfilling your needs, whether due to inadequate service or shifting business circumstances, it is essential to follow the appropriate procedures. Each state has specific registered agent requirements that dictate how you can modify your agent, so be sure to consult your state's guidelines to ensure compliance.
To start the change, you will typically need to complete a registered agent change form and submit it to your state’s Secretary of State or relevant authority. This form will require details such as your business name, the new registered agent's name and address, and the effective date of the change. Some states may also have a nominal fee associated with submitting this change. It’s essential to also verify that your new registered agent fulfills all statutory agent requirements to avoid any compliance issues.
After submitting the necessary documents, notify all relevant parties and clients about the change in your registered agent. This includes letting know your new registered agent to make sure they are prepared to handle service of process and compliance notifications for your business. Keeping open communication with all concerned parties helps maintain seamless operations and compliance with legal responsibilities.
